Yahbut...in WWII the US submarine force which including its shore support
personnel was only 2 percent of the US Navy was responsible for 55 percent
of Japanese merchant and naval shipping losses.  Personnel war losses, as a
percentage of all submarine personnel, were a fraction of a percent *higher*
than the personnel losses of the Eighth Air Force in their daylight bombing
raids in the ETO.  It was a far more effective submarine force than any other
of the war, including (even especially) the German submarine force.

It sounds like it was worth the money.
